3.4 Hononga Ororongo

The soundbar offers versatile connectivity options. Choose the connection method that best suits your devices:

  • HDMI (ARC): For optimal audio quality and control via your TV remote, connect the included HDMI cable from the soundbar's HDMI (ARC) port to your TV's HDMI (ARC/eARC) port.
  • Optical: Connect the included optical cable from the soundbar's OPTICAL port to your TV's optical output.
  • AUX: Use the included 3.5mm audio cable to connect the soundbar's AUX port to the audio output of your device (e.g., TV headphone jack, PC).
  • USB: Insert a USB drive into the USB port for direct MP3 playback.
  • Nihokikorangi 5.3: For wireless connection with smartphones, tablets, or other Bluetooth-enabled devices.

4.5 Takirua Nihokikorangi

Hei hono ma te Nihokikorangi:

  1. Select Bluetooth input on the soundbar. The indicator light will flash.
  2. Enable Bluetooth on your device (smartphone, tablet).
  3. Rapua "TONOR SL4000" in your device's Bluetooth settings and select it to pair.
  4. Once connected, the indicator light will be solid.
